News

Object-oriented design (OOD) is a widely used approach to software development that focuses on ... You can also use tools like UML diagrams, CRC cards, or class diagrams to visualize and document ...
In this paper, we propose an approach for determining the design quality of Object Oriented Software System. The approach makes use of a set of UML diagrams created during the design phase of the ...
Object Diagram: show relationships between ... or business by applying object-oriented programming, as well as using visual modeling throughout the software development process to guide stakeholder ...
Software behaviors can be expressed in different ways, such as pseudocode, natural language, diagrams or formal specifications. In the object-oriented approach, the importance is on documenting ...
The Object-Process Methodology (OPM) has been shown to successfully describe the structure and behavior of systems by combining objects and processes within an integrated, coherent set of ...
The purpose of UML is to provide a simple and common method to visualise a software system’s inherent architectural properties. Over time, UML has become the de-facto standard of building ...
Object-oriented analysis and design (OOAD) is a technical approach for analyzing and designing an application, system, or business by applying object-oriented programming, as well as using visual ...
Abstract: Object-oriented ... software testing and quality assurance engineers, and project managers. Conceptual use case diagrams that draw on critical analysis can enhance a project manager's ...
Scenario diagrams are a well-known notation for visualizing the message flow in object- oriented systems. Traditionally, they are used in the analysis and design phases of software development to ...
In the ever-evolving world of technology, innovation is not just a process ... bridges the gap between hardware and software development. Object-oriented programming, the foundation of modern ...